Press "Enter" to skip to content

複数のWordPressを一つのデータベースに設置する方法!

会社の同僚に、Wordpressを複数設置するにはどうしたら良いか聞かれ、ブログで返事してと謎の指令?wをもらったので、簡単にメモしておきます。

Movable Typeなどは元々複数のブログが運営できるシステムですがWordPressは個別のブログのシステムとなっています。
WordPress3.0になってから「マルチサイト」というこれまでWordPressMUで提供されていた機能が使えるようになっているようですが、この「マルチサイト」は、あまりメリットを感じられないので自分は昔ながらの方法で個別に管理しています。

その方法をちょこっとまとめ。

レンタルサーバなどでデータベースを利用する際、いくつもデータベースを利用できる所はいいのですが、一つしか使えない場合、そのままではWordPressは一つしか利用できません。

で、複数設置したい場合は、「wp-config.php」の中身を変更します。
ページの下の方に「WordPress データベーステーブルの接頭辞」という項目があります。

通常は

$table_prefix = ‘wp_’;

という記述になっていますが、二つ目以降のWordPressを設置する際は、この「wp_」の部分を変更していきます。

例えば

$table_prefix = ‘wp_new_‘;

のように。

これでインストールを行うと、データベースに登録されるテーブルの頭文字を区分けする事ができ、複数のWordPressを一つのデータベースで共存できるようになります。

簡単なので是非お試しあれ!

Be First to Comment

Popular Posts